Description

A flaw was found in the Keylime registrar that could allow a bypass of the challenge-response protocol during agent registration. This issue may allow an attacker to impersonate an agent and hide the true status of a monitored machine if the fake agent is added to the verifier list by a legitimate user, resulting in a breach of the integrity of the registrar database.

Fixing This On Your OS

If you run this on a Linux distribution, patch through your package manager against the distro's own security advisory below — it tracks the exact backported fix for your release, which can ship on a different timeline (and sometimes a different severity) than the upstream project.

Red HatModerate
ProductFixed inAdvisory
Red Hat Enterprise Linux 9keylime-0:6.5.2-6.el9_2RHSA-2023:5080
